What is the process for getting a bail bond?

Asked 3 months ago
The process for obtaining a bail bond typically involves several steps that are designed to ensure both the release of the accused individual and the protection of the bail bond company. While each bail bond agency, including AAA Bail Bonds, may have its own specific procedures, the general steps tend to be quite similar. Initially, a person who has been arrested appears before a judge, who sets the bail amount based on various factors, including the nature of the charges and the individual’s criminal history. Once the bail amount is determined and if the accused individual cannot afford to pay the entire amount, they may seek the assistance of a bail bond agency. To begin the process, the individual or a family member or friend will contact a bail bond agent. During this initial conversation, important details about the case will be gathered, including the full name of the accused, the location of the detention facility, the charges, and the bail amount. Afterward, the bail agent will explain the terms of the bail bond, including the premium that must be paid, which is typically a percentage of the total bail amount. Once everyone agrees to the terms, the next step involves filling out paperwork, which may include providing personal information and signing a contract. The bail agent may also require collateral to secure the bond. After completing the necessary documentation and securing the required payment, the bail bond agency will post the bail with the court. Upon processing, the accused will be released from custody, and the bail bond agency assumes the responsibility of ensuring that the individual appears for all required court hearings. It is essential for anyone considering a bail bond to carefully review all terms and conditions to fully understand their obligations.
